Eleven workers on a World Bank project got better in Balochistan.

Police sources stated that eleven officials and workers from a World Bank-funded project who had been kidnapped in Khuzdar have been found.
Police say the victims were taken from the Karkh area of Khuzdar district on October 22 while they were working on a World Bank-funded project to build water lines.
The project manager for a private company that was in charge of the project was one of the people who were taken.
Six of the workers who were taken were from Sindh.
Police sources said that all eleven people were found late last night, and Khuzdar police have confirmed that they were found.
